STILLWATER, Oklahoma, June 8 (TNSawa) -- Oklahoma State University issued the following news:
The Aerospace Propulsion and Power Program (APOP) Black Team from the College of Engineering, Architecture and Technology at Oklahoma State University won the Air Force Research Lab's end-of-the-year challenge in Dayton, Ohio.
